Transaction 575d3103d158473984a21850482958499372ba6b8d4302d127c1bbf85cc3164e

1 Input
1 Outputs
  • 575d3103d158473984a21850482958499372ba6b8d4302d127c1bbf85cc3164e:0
  • value  65583
    address  3FtNfvcTzcDcKyGvasaSMzKZH1Q8659U8c